I treat my little coco starter pucks with actinovate, any sort of broad use fungicide should work, to help prevent damping off. My success rate of plants making it out of seedling stage and into small plants went way up. I never had any issues and then all of a sudden started losing lots of sprouts so had to switch it up a bit. I just add the fungicide to whatever water I am using to rehydrate the pucks, have done the same with cups of coco and also started doing it with clones. Ounce of prevention hopefully leading to pounds of cured as my modified version of the old saying goes.

Something is messed up for sure. Germ in a root riot pod or something. Pinch a corner off to cover it. That thing should be wet but not dripping. One or two sprays of water over the top in a warm place in a dome or something. 3 days tops, move to a solo. Make sure you have a drain hole.
